Job description

Position Description

Position Description
The Physics Department at Seattle University is inviting applications for twopart-time adjunctfacultyforthe 2026-27 academic year.Position 1willteach one section ofalgebra-based introductory mechanics, PHYS 1050in Fall Quarter and two sections of introductory physics laboratory in each of Fall, Winter, and Spring Quarters.Position 2will teach 4 sections ofintroductoryphysics laboratory in Fall Quarter only.The instructorsmust be available on campusfor in-person instruction and office hours.

MinimumQualifications

  • Master's degree in physics or a related discipline; or bachelor's degree plus three years graduate study in physics

  • Demonstrated interest or experience teaching at the college level

Application Instructions
Applicants should submit applications online at

www.seattleu.edu/careers, including acover letter andCurriculum Vitae/Resume.Open until filled.

Benefits at a Glance

Consistent with its fundamental Jesuit values, Seattle University offers a wide range of benefits designed to care for the whole person. Choose from three different medical plans, a dental, and vision insurance programs. Protect your income with life, short & long-term disability coverage. Plan for your future with up to a 10% employer contribution for retirement benefits, comprised of a 5% non elective employer contribution and an additional dollar-for-dollar match of your voluntary contributions up to a maximum of 5%. You may also take advantage of 100% paid tuition benefits for the employee and dependents, a subsidized transportation benefit, a wellness program with free access to an onsite fitness facility, and a wide variety of campus events.
